About
Panama is a Central American country located on the isthmus connecting North and South America. It is globally known for the Panama Canal, a strategic waterway linking the Atlantic and Pacific Oceans. The country has a diversified economy with an important financial sector and a multicultural population.
Safety
Risk areas
Crime(Medium)
- Avoid nighttime travel outside tourist areas
- Do not display signs of wealth (jewelry, expensive electronics)
- Use official taxis or trusted transport services
- Remain vigilant in shopping areas and public transportation
Terrorism(Low)
- No major terrorist threat identified
- Stay informed about local news
Transport
- Use official taxis with meters or authorized transport services
- Avoid public transportation late at night
- Follow traffic rules
Natural risks(Moderate risks including earthquakes, tropical storms, and seasonal floods)
- Familiarize yourself with evacuation procedures in case of an earthquake
- Follow weather alerts during storm season (May to November)
- Have an emergency plan and reserves of water and food
Health(Adequate healthcare system in urban areas. Panama is committed to increasing healthcare spending by over 11 million dollars. Private medical facilities are of good quality in Panama City.)
- Yellow fever vaccination recommended
- Prevention against dengue and Zika (use mosquito repellents)
- Obtain international health insurance
- Consult a doctor before travel for recommended vaccinations
- Tap water generally safe in main urban areas
Practical tips
- Register your contact details with your embassy
- Keep copies of important documents
- Keep emergency numbers handy
- Avoid protests and political gatherings
- Respect local laws, especially regarding drugs
